On April 9, 2024, the Office of Childhood (OOC) received an allegation that on April 8, 2024, Child A (2-years-old) had an altercation with another child(ren) and came home with bruises and scratches all over his face, hands, and under his chin. The daycare did not file an incident report and the staff members did not appear to know about the altercation. After conducting an investigation, Compliance Inspector (CI) Ian Fyfe has found this allegation to be substantiated based on the following evidence:
5 CSR 25-500.192(5)(A), which states that: "In case of accident or injury to a child, the provider shall notify the parent(s) immediately. If the child requires emergency medical care, the provider shall follow the parent's(s') written instructions."
AND
5 CSR 25-500.192(5)(B), which states that: "Information regarding the date and circumstance of any accident or injury shall be noted in the child's record."
On April 23, 2024, Compliance Inspector (CI) Ian Fyfe conducted an unannounced inspection to Strawberry International Schools of St. John and interviewed Director Shawiesha White and 2-year-old Caregiver Jodi Enloe. Ms. White was familiar with the reported concerns, but Ms. Enloe was not. On April 8, 2024, Child A was involved in an incident in the 2-year-old classroom in which another child scratched him on his face. Staff did not notify Parent A of this injury to Child A. Ms. White stated that she did not see any injuries on Child A prior to him leaving for the day but did see scratches on his face the following day when he returned to the facility and Parent A had contacted Ms. White once she returned home on April 08, 2024 and asked how Child A got his scratches on his face. An accident report for this incident was not present in Child A's facility record. Parent A (parent of Child A) was not notified of the incident after it had occurred. Child A is still attending the facility at the time of this conclusion.
On April 24, 2024, and on April 30, 2024, CI Fyfe attempted to interview Parent A (parent of Child A) via phone call but was unsuccessful in the attempts.
